Characters should have less health or take more drive damage

Historically, Akuma/Gouki was the high pressure glass cannon character, he has had the least amount of health and stun for that reason.

Fast forward to sf6, he’s still considered strong, but in the grand scheme of things has similar levels of pressure and damage output with the tools he has.

Stun gauge is no longer in the equation at all, so that weakness is no longer an issue.

Imo, it feels fine fighting Akuma because of his health, but playing against the other similar top tiers feels sorta unbalanced.

At this point, just make akuma have 10k health or make the other top tiers have less health too.

Alternatively, have them take more drive damage compared to regular cast
